qt的ui文件转pyqt
时间: 2024-10-25 15:15:54 浏览: 31
Python Pyqt5 自适应UI 导入本地Excel
Qt的UI文件(通常扩展名为`.ui`)是Qt Designer工具创建的用户界面设计文件,它们描述了应用程序的布局和控件配置。要将`.ui`文件转换成Python代码(PyQt),你可以按照以下步骤操作:
1. **安装所需的库**:首先确保已经安装了PyQt5及其相关的uic工具。如果你还没有安装,可以使用pip安装:
```
pip install PyQt5 pyuic5
```
2. **运行uic工具**:在命令行中,导航到包含UI文件的目录,然后运行`pyuic5`命令来生成Python源码:
```bash
pyuic5 -o your_script.py your_ui_file.ui
```
这里的`your_script.py`是你想生成的Python脚本名称,`your_ui_file.ui`则是你的UI设计文件名。
3. **查看并编辑生成的代码**:生成的`your_script.py`文件会有一个或多个类,每个类对应UI设计中的一个窗口。你需要查看这个文件,其中包含了对控件的初始化、信号和槽等设置。
4. **导入并在主程序中使用**:在你的主Python程序中,导入并实例化这个生成的类,就可以使用设计好的用户界面了。
阅读全文